摘要
Four-quadrant (4Q) photodetectors are widely utilized in quick light tracking and positioning through differential signal processing. However, it is a challenge to track light in a large dynamic space with high speed and simple signal processing. In this letter, a positioning method is proposed based on a back-to-back n + -p − -p + -p − -n + structure formed by two adjacent quadrants. It is found the turn-on voltage of this particular structure is sensitive to the light incident position when a light spot is located inside a single quadrant. A 1 mm positioning resolution is achieved for a 4Q photodetector with a diameter of 11.3 mm. This method provides a supplementary positioning scheme for a large-area 4Q photodetector that exhibits the advantages of high positioning accuracy and simple signal processing with high speed.
